Abstract

It is presented a pipe connector ( 1 ) comprising a tubular part ( 2 ) having a first portion ( 2 - 1 ) with a first outer diameter and second portion ( 2 - 2 ) with a second outer diameter which is larger than the first outer diameter, which second portion has a circumferential groove ( 11 ), a removable stop ring ( 5 ), which, when arranged in the groove ( 11 ), protrudes radially from the tubular part ( 2 ), and a flange part ( 7 ) having a central through opening for receiving the tubular part ( 2 ), wherein the flange part ( 7 ) has a shoulder ( 13 ) for abutting against the stop ring ( 5 ) when the flange part ( 7 ) is arranged around the stop ring ( 5 ), wherein the first portion ( 2 - 1 ) has a plastic external peripheral surface, and the second portion ( 2 - 2 ) of the tubular part ( 2 ) has a metal external peripheral surface.

The invention claimed is: 
     
       1. A pipe connector comprising:
 a tubular metal part having a first portion with a first outer diameter and a second portion with second outer diameter which is larger than the first outer diameter, which second portion has a circumferential groove, 
 a removable stop ring, which, when arranged in the groove, protrudes radially from the tubular metal part, and 
 a flange part having a central through opening for receiving the tubular metal part, wherein the flange part has a shoulder for abutting against the stop ring when the flange part is arranged around the stop ring, 
 wherein the pipe connector has a first end face at the first portion and a second end face at the second portion, wherein a length of the pipe connector is defined by a distance between the first end face and the second end face, wherein a longitudinal extension of the pipe connector is along a single central axis; and 
 wherein each of the outer diameters and of the first portion and the second portion of the tubular metal part are smaller than a diameter of the central through opening of the flange part, wherein the pipe connector further comprises another tubular part comprising a tubular plastic part having a plastic external peripheral surface, wherein a periphery of the tubular plastic part is arranged around a tubular metal surface of the first portion of the tubular metal part. 
 
     
     
       2. The pipe connector as claimed in  claim 1 , wherein the second portion and the tubular metal surface of the first portion forms a one-piece metal unit. 
     
     
       3. The pipe connector as claimed in  claim 1 , wherein the tubular plastic part has a length that is shorter than the length of the first portion of the tubular metal part. 
     
     
       4. The pipe connector as claimed in  claim 1 , wherein the second portion has an outer diameter d 2  which is larger than an outer diameter d 3  of the tubular plastic part. 
     
     
       5. The pipe connector as claimed in  claim 1 , wherein the outer diameter d 2  of the tubular metal part at the groove is at least as large as an outer diameter d 3  of the tubular plastic part. 
     
     
       6. The pipe connector as claimed in  claim 1 , wherein the tubular metal part has a greater axial extension than the flange part. 
     
     
       7. The pipe connector as claimed in  claim 1 , wherein the inner diameter dl of the tubular metal part is constant. 
     
     
       8. The pipe connector as claimed in  claim 1 , wherein the stop ring has a slit. 
     
     
       9. The pipe connector as claimed in  claim 1 , wherein the flange part has a radially extending first flange surface extending between the through opening and the outer periphery of the flange part, wherein the first flange surface aligns with an end face of the tubular metal part when the shoulder mates with the stop ring. 
     
     
       10. The pipe connector as claimed in  claim 1 , further comprising a removable inner pipe coupling part having an outer diameter smaller than the inner diameter of the tubular metal part, wherein the inner pipe coupling part protrudes from the tubular plastic part when arranged in the tubular metal part. 
     
     
       11. The pipe connector as claimed in  claim 10 , wherein the inner pipe coupling part comprises a conductive material. 
     
     
       12. The pipe connector as claimed in  claim 1 , further comprising a fixing device for fixing a portion of the tubular plastic part around the first portion of the tubular metal part. 
     
     
       13. The pipe connector as claimed in  claim 12 , wherein the fixing device is cylindrical and is arranged to receive the tubular plastic part. 
     
     
       14. The pipe connector as claimed in  claim 1 , wherein the first portion comprises a plurality of peripheral protrusions.
